wcspbrk - search a wide-character string for any of a set of wide characters
The wcspbrk() function is the wide-character equivalent of the strp- brk(3) function. It searches for the first occurrence in the wide- character string pointed to by wcs of any of the characters in the wide-character string pointed to by accept.
The wcspbrk() function returns a pointer to the first occurrence in wcs of any of the characters listed in accept. If wcs contains none of these characters, NULL
is returned.
